This has been driving me crazy!  /usr/share/doc/opendmarc/README.gz points to 
/etc/default/opendmarc which no longer exists.
/usr/share/zcot/opendmarc/NEWS.Debian.gz finally explained that the 
/etc/default/opendmarc is now 
/etc/systemd/system/opendmarc.service.d/overrride.conf but offers no advice on 
the format of that file.

Please update the documentation to be less confusing.
